COLOMBIA. 1765-JV 8 Escudos. Santa Fe de Nuevo Reino (Bogotá) mint. Carlos III (1759-1788). Restrepo M71.6a. AU-55 (PCGS).
Choice medium yellow gold with a good deal of luster, particularly on the reverse. Aside from a little nick on the king's nose, no other flaws are noteworthy. Well struck and well centered with great color and surface quality. The left obverse field shows swelling, and the reverse die is cracked beneath the NR mintmark to the fleece. Unusually nice.
